Abstract

A modification of the method of typing of human apolipoprotein E gene described by Hixson JE and Vernier DT. The analysis of the complete sequence of the apolipoprotein E (NG 007 084) and the nucleotide sequences of SNP rs429358 and rs7412 identified six nucleotide mismatches in the structure of the forward primer and reverse seven. Despite the impossibility of carrying out PCR amplification using oligonucleotide primers described Hixson JE and Vernier DT method was repeated several times with the publication of the results of several authors. To resolve this discrepancy was designed structure of oligonucleotide primers which give specific amplification products and carry out genotyping using endonuclease Hha I.
